EOCT vs. APRQ
EOCT (Innovator Emerging Markets Power Buffer ETF - October) and APRQ (Innovator Premium Income 40 Barrier ETF - April) are both Options Trading funds from Innovator. Both are actively managed. EOCT charges 0.89%/yr vs 0.79%/yr for APRQ.
